What is a Hoverboard Weight Limit and How is it the Deciding Factor?
Riding a self-balancing scooter is a new, fun, and cool thing. Everybody likes to hover around on these self-balancing scooters but it is a fact that you can’t do everything you want. There are certain limits and the weight limits of a hoverboard are one of them.
There is a large variety of hoverboards in the market. Every hoverboard supports different weight capacities depending on the material they are built-up on, the motors, the batteries, the terrain, and the wheel size. Hence you must have to consider all these factors.
Every hoverboard possesses some specific specs as its trait so as the weight-bearing capacity. It’s always the prime factor for the selection of a hoverboard. Crossing the weight limits mentioned in the manual can cause a serious threat to your security.
You may run out of battery in the midway, the uncontrolled/rough ride, or your hoverboard may crash into pieces, or even no stroll at all.
Therefore, BE MINDFUL!
P.S:
Always sum up the backpack or hand carry weight and your body weight to get the total weight before stepping up on the hoverboard. The total weight must be less than the Max weight limit of the hoverboard.
Total Weight = Hand-carry Weight + Body Weight
Total Weight < The Max Weight Limit of The Hoverboard
After talking about the maximum weight-bearing capacity of the hoverboard, is there any recommended minimum weight limit for the hoverboard?
As we said, there are no such laws about them but yes stepping out of the recommended limits can bring unfortunate experiences. So the suggested minimum weight for riding a hoverboard must be 44lbs. Check out the Age Limit Law for Children.
